Laybuy in receivership: Deloitte considers offers for NZ and Australia operations

Offers to purchase collapsed buy-now-pay-later service Laybuy are being considered, receivers say.On June 17, the Laybuy group of companies in New Zealand and Australia was placed in receivership after directors voluntarily requested the appointment of Deloitte as receivers.Laybuy Group Holdings and Laybuy Holdings receiver David Webb said administrators were appointed to Laybuy's UK business on June 24 and that the receivers were working closely with them.Receivers were seeking a buyer for the group of Laybuy companies in receivership and...
